Tucked deep in a maze of immense red rock canyons and ancient mining complexes lies Crimson Gorge—a sprawling network of makeshift dwellings, repurposed industrial relics, and secret tunnels that serve as the beating heart of The Iron Veins insurgency. The pragmatic, miner-led insurgents have transformed this harsh landscape into both a fortress and a training ground, repurposing abandoned passages and mining equipment to forge a communal stronghold against external threats.
The defenders expertly exploit the treacherous terrain, setting up choke points and hidden firing positions that turn every canyon into a potential trap for unwanted visitors. Occasional RSD patrol sweeps through the larger canyon mouths highlight the precarious nature of life in the Gorge, where even a minor incursion can turn into a battle for survival. Amid this constant state of alert, Crimson Gorge remains a symbol of defiance—a place where revolutionary fervor, strategic alliances with profit-driven elements of the Ghost Market, and the sustained effort of its inhabitants continue to shape its storied legacy.
